What are the responsibilities and job description for the Marketing Coordinator position at Howard Building Corporation?
Description
JOB DESCRIPTION
Assist the Sr Director of Marketing & Technology and Creative Manager with client RFP responses and general marketing, social media marketing, internal communications, and brand awareness efforts. The Marketing Coordinator will work semi-independently in the Los Angeles office with LA-based Project Management Teams while coordinating with other Marketing staff in our Orange County office.
This is a non-exempt position as defined by the Fair Labor Standards Act and subject to overtime.
ROUTINE D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
- Create client RFP responses using Adobe InDesign and similar software to fit Project Team and Client requirements.
- Develop and update project and personnel-related marketing material for use in proposal/qualification packages.
- Create and edit marketing material and company forms (electronic and print).
- Write copy for company experience, employee bios, award submissions, web/newsletter content, miscellaneous brochures, and as-needed marketing content.
- Create social media outreach and produce content for LinkedIn, Facebook, Instagram, and YouTube as well as research and keep up with future social media apps.
- Edit existing marketing database used to track projects and opportunities. Issue bid and job numbers. Follow up with Business Development and Project Management Teams for weekly updates.
- Assist with website content as needed (ie: post new photos, career opportunities, company news, etc.).
- Provide general support to the Marketing and Business Development departments (ie: attend weekly Marketing and Business Development team meetings, general administrative tasks, etc.).
Requirements
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
- Required software knowledge: Adobe InDesign, Photoshop, Acrobat, Microsoft Office, and Microsoft CRM (cloud database).
- Experience with graphic design, layout, and creative content using InDesign is required.
- A degree or relevant coursework in a related field is preferred.
- 3 years of experience in Marketing preferred.
- Excellent communication and writing skills are required.
- Effective proof-reading and editing skills are also a must.
- Detail oriented and able to prioritize, multi-task, and meet deadlines.
- Able to work independently as well as with various internal teams to gather marketing information.
